ADMV4420ACPZ-R2 Overview
The ADMV4420ACPZ-R2 is a state-of-the-art, high-performance voltage-controlled oscillator (VCO) designed for demanding industrial and communications applications. Operating within a frequency range of 17.5 GHz to 20.5 GHz, this device delivers excellent phase noise performance, low power consumption, and robust temperature stability. Its compact, surface-mount package ensures easy integration into complex RF systems. Ideal for engineers and sourcing specialists seeking a reliable, precise frequency source, the ADMV4420ACPZ-R2 supports advanced wireless infrastructure and radar systems with exceptional signal purity and frequency agility. ADMV4420ACPZ-R2 Technical Specifications
|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Frequency Range | 17.5 GHz to 20.5 GHz |
| Phase Noise (typical at 1 MHz offset) | -110 dBc/Hz |
| Control Voltage Range | 0.5 V to 4.5 V |
| Supply Voltage | +5 V |
| Output Power | +7 dBm (typical) |
| Operating Temperature Range | -40 ??C to +85 ??C |
| Package Type | Surface-Mount, 6 mm ?? 6 mm LFCSP |
| Current Consumption | 25 mA (typical) |
| Frequency Tuning Sensitivity | 500 MHz/V (typical) |

Typical Applications
- High-frequency wireless communication systems requiring low phase noise and wideband tuning, such as microwave backhaul links and point-to-point radios.
- Commercial and military radar systems where frequency stability and purity directly impact detection performance.
- Signal generators and test equipment needing precise, agile frequency sources for calibration and measurement tasks.
- Satellite communication transceivers demanding robust, compact oscillators with wide tuning capability under harsh environmental conditions.
